Transaction 5434173f7d69d96047c7a59760028ec81abd09c7a55d4ee052a0c3e16bcc086d

2 Input
2 Outputs
  • 5434173f7d69d96047c7a59760028ec81abd09c7a55d4ee052a0c3e16bcc086d:0
  • value  24711225
    address  1CfpNKxYft1PuQfH5wyEPVH2QFmGGHU9ob
  • 5434173f7d69d96047c7a59760028ec81abd09c7a55d4ee052a0c3e16bcc086d:1
  • value  1111532
    address  1KCW9jH3hv8kbZJZpTtX78pXy16D4JR4a1